12 people injured in clash during Jajpur pala event
Kendrapada: Twelve people were injured after a dispute escalated into a violent clash between two groups at Kasaba village under Mangalpur police station limits in Jajpur district on Monday night. The injured were taken to community health centre at Mangalpur.The clash broke between two groups from Bautra Sahi and Jia Sahi of the village during the concluding night of a three-day pala event organised at the Kasaba Pala Mandap. Supporters of both groups pelted stones and bricks at each other resulting in injuries to many people. “Following the incident, the pala was halted midway. The exact cause of the hostility between them is being investigated,” said IIC, Mangalpur police station, Ranjan Kumar Behera.The situation was brought under control as soon as police reached the spot. Security has been tightened at Kasaba and its nearby areas. A platoon of police has been deployed in the area, said Behera.Both sides blamed each other for the incident. “Every year, villagers organise pala competition and invite singers to perform in the village. It is unfortunate that some miscreants abused some singers for which both groups clashed with each other,” said Rajendra Behera, a villager. Tensions escalated following an argument triggered by objectionable comments, which quickly turned into a physical confrontation.
